Output 21ab59fb5e74c16d8820f7299f28238e3a139886dc18725df369e1920a431bb7:18

value
1522549
script pubkey
OP_0 OP_PUSHBYTES_20 c691b19b9c9c4a3f3c3fc9d962299bdb8a7bb370
address
bc1qc6gmrxuun39r70ple8vky2vmmw98hvmsce94jq
transaction
21ab59fb5e74c16d8820f7299f28238e3a139886dc18725df369e1920a431bb7